Spellbinding
Spellbinding adjective - Attracting and holding interest as if by a spell.
Stirring and spellbinding are semantically related. In some cases you can use "Stirring" instead an adjective "Spellbinding".

Stirring
Stirring adjective - Causing great emotional or mental stimulation.
Usage example: the message of brotherhood in Martin Luther King's stirring “I Have a Dream” speech still resonates today
Spellbinding and stirring are semantically related. Sometimes you can use "Spellbinding" instead an adjective "Stirring".
